EFA GROUP comprises companies in Aerospace, Security, Defense, and Industrial Cooperation with a solid international presence. EFA GROUP currently employs more than 280 people, most of whom are engineers and scientists. The GROUP has established offices across 6 international regions: Greece, Cyprus, Switzerland, USA, UAE, and Singapore to serve its customers in 34 countries worldwide. EFA GROUP is an ecosystem of 13 companies, split in 4 thematic clusters: Unmanned & Autonomous Systems, Mission Systems Simulation and Training, Integrated Solutions, and Sensors & Targeting.
